Description

(R,R)-GSK321 is a wild-type isocitrate dehydrogenase 1 (WT IDH1) inhibitor with an IC50 value of 120 nM. (R,R)-GSK321 as a mutant R132H IDH1 inhibitor, is an isomer of GSK321 with some wild-type cross reactivity[1].

IC50 & Target

IDH1

 

In Vitro

(R,R)-GSK321 (0.1~3 μM; 5 hours; A-498 cells) dose dependent decreases in reductive glutaminolysis[1].
